Six Days in Fallujah Reemerges a Decade Later for a 2021 Release on Consoles, PC
Publisher Victura and developer Highwire Games today announced Six Days in Fallujah, resurrecting a project long thought dead.
Originally announced in 2009 by developer Atomic Games, Six Days in Fallujah was a first-person tactical military shooter based on the true Second Battle for Fallujah in 2004. The title was abandoned by original publisher Konami following controversy over the subject matter. Now, the game is back with a new publisher and developer made up of many of core leadership team behind the Halo and Destiny franchises (Jaime Griesemer, Marty O’Donnel).
